How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lowry Field?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Lowry Field Studio Apartments | $1,376 | $1,021 | $1,720 |
| Lowry Field 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,842 | $950 | $8,080 |
| Lowry Field 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,239 | $1,350 | $7,094 |
| Lowry Field 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,742 | $2,250 | $4,220 |

Cheapest Available Lowry Field Studio Apartments
Currently the lowest priced Studio apartment unit Lowry Field of Denver, CO is the S1 Model starting from $1,049 at The Harper. The average price for all Studio apartments in Lowry Field is currently $1,376.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available Studio options in the area: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Priced From |
|---|---|---|
| The Harper | S1 | $1,049 |
| Avalon Lowry | S1-Alt Finish Package 2 | $1,526 |
| Alas Over Lowry | Robie | $1,720 |
